Controls on the system and remote control

1STANDBY ON (PWR 2)

switches the system to standby or on.

2 iR SENSOR

infrared sensor for remote control.

3 SOURCE

selects the respective sound source for CD/ TAPE/TUNER/AUX.

switches on the system.

4ALBUM/PRESET +/-

for radio

selects a preset radio station.

for MP3/WMA

.. selects an album.

5 DBB

(Dynamic Bass Boost)

enhances the bass.

6 TUNING 4 ¢

for Tuner

tunes to radio stations.

for CD

skips to the beginning of the

 

current/previous/subsequent

 

track.

.................................

fast searches back and forward

 

within a track/CD.

for clock/timer

adjusts the hours and minutes

 

for the clock/timer function

AUX jack (located on the back panel)

connects an external source (3.5 mm socket)

HEADPHONE (located on the back panel)

connects headphones

Controls available on the remote control only

#REP ALL

for CD ................. selects Repeat All play mode. for MP3/WMA .. selects Repart All or Repeat

Album play mode.

$SHUF

plays CD/MP3 tracks in random order.

% REP

plays a track repeatedly.

^SLEEP

activates/deactivates or selects the sleeper time.

& TIMER ON/OFF

Turns on or off timer

*TIMER

sets the timer function.

( 2;

starts or interrupts CD playback.

à / á

English

VOL +/-

adjusts the volume level.

7 2;

starts or interrupts CD playback.

8 MODE

selects Repeat One, Repeat All, Repeat Album

(for MP3/WMA only) or Shuffle play mode

9PROG

for CD

programmes tracks and reviews

 

the programme.

for Tuner

programmes tuner stations

 

manually or automatically.

09

stops CD playback or erases a CD programme.

! PULL TO OPEN

opens/closes the CD door.

@Tape Deck Operation RECORD● ... starts recording.

PLAY 2 ............ starts playback.

SEARCHà / á fast rewinds/winds the tape.

STOP•OPENÇ0

................................. stops the tape; opens the tape

compartment.

PAUSEÅ ....... interrupts recording or playback.

for Tuner

tunes to radio stations.

for CD

fast searches back and forward

 

within a track/CD.

for clock/timer

adjusts the hours and minutes

 

for the clock/timer function

¡ / ™

 

for CD

skips to the beginning of the

 

current/previous/subsequent

 

track.

)DSC

(Digital Sound Control) selects sound characteristics: JAZZ/POP/CLASSIC/ROCK.

¡MUTE

interrupts and resumes sound reproduction.

VOL +/-

adjusts the volume level.

£Numeric keypad (0-9)

selects track or station number

CLOCK/DISPLAY

for CD

displays the track playing time,

 

remaining time, total play time

 

and total remaining time.

for MP3/WMA ..

displays the current title name,

 

album name and ID3

 

information.

for clock

sets/views the clock.
